Why is the internet speed so slow when it rains in my home?

The main reason for the slow network speed when it rains is that the internal or external lines or equipment are wet, which affects the efficiency. Handle the internal ones by yourself, and call the operator to handle the external ones. At the same time, improve the network by other means to increase the network speed.
